    • Description

      Château Margaux 2005 stands as a shining example of this legendary First Growth estate, delivering extraordinary depth, balance, and elegance. A blend dominated by Cabernet Sauvignon, it reflects the estate’s hallmark finesse, with layers of blackcurrant, floral notes, and refined tannins that promise decades of evolution. The 2005 vintage, one of the finest in modern history, benefited from ideal conditions that enhanced both power and precision. With a lineage tracing back centuries and an unwavering commitment to quality, Château Margaux remains an enduring icon of Bordeaux winemaking.
